MUHAMMAD SHARIF versus JUDGE, FAMILY COURT, BAHAWALPUR
Section 5 of the West Pakistan Family Court Act 1964, Schedule 14 and Constitution of Pakistan (1973), Article 199 Constitutional Petition for Rehabilitation Trial has been ordered and rehabilitation for minors is Rs. 700 per month. Given at the rate of. It was challenged by the defendant to maintain the constitutional petition against the judgment and order of the trial; if the restitution allowance of each minor was fixed by 500 pm, the section of the West Pakistan Family Courts Act 1964 Appeal could not be filed under section 14 and the only way was to challenge this order by filing a constitutional petition. If the restoration allowance of each minor was fixed at Rs. 700 per month, then only the respondent / applicant. Had to go to the available file district judge. Appeal and then he can approach the High Court if he is upset over the decision of the appellate court / p. The petitioner did not seek legal recourse, dismissed for not being able to maintain constitutional petition
